contents We give a uniform and self-contained proof that if $G$ is a connected graph with $χ(G) = Δ(G)$ and $G\neq \overline{C_7}$, then $G$ contains either $K_{Δ(G)}$ or an odd hole where every vertex has degree at least $Δ(G)-1$ in $G$. This was previously proved in series of two papers by Chen, Lan, Lin, and Zhou, who used the Strong Perfect Graph Theorem for the cases $Δ(G)=4, 5, 6$.
